WebNFP = Glomerular blood hydrostatic pressure (GBHP) – [capsular hydrostatic pressure (CHP) + blood colloid osmotic pressure (BCOP)] = 10 mm Hg. Web28 dec. 2024 · This severe pain occurs when the kidney stone breaks loose from the place that it formed, the renal papilla, and falls into the urinary collecting system. When this happens, the stone can block the drainage of urine from the kidney, a condition known as renal colic. The pain may begin in the lower back and may move to the side or the groin. Each human kidney contains about 1,200,000 nephrons, a number that does not increase after birth. In situations of compensatory hypertrophy, such as after nephrectomy, the increase in kidney size is due to an increase in the size of the nephron, but not the number. shantel newWeb15 feb. 2024 · Anatomy.
